On February 15, various celebrations were held throughout Canada to mark the 50th anniversary of the Canadian maple-leaf flag. CG VanKoughnett attended a flag raising ceremony on Her Majesty’s Canadian Ship Montcalm. During the event, he met with the Honorable Pierre Duchesne, Lieutenant Governor of Quebec, and representatives of the federal, provincial, and municipal governments.

The Canadian flag bill was adopted by the House of Commons on December 15, 1964, and then two days later by the Senate. The new flag flew for the first time on February 15, 1965.
